Sedan, SUV or Sprinter Van? Choosing the Right Airport Transportation
The right airport vehicle is determined by more than the number of available seats. Passenger comfort, checked bags, carry-ons, car seats, strollers and special equipment all affect which option will work well on travel day.

When an executive sedan makes sense
An executive sedan is often a comfortable choice for one or two travelers with standard luggage. It suits corporate travelers, couples and individual airport trips where a quiet ride and efficient pickup matter more than maximum cargo capacity.
A sedan may not be the right option when passengers have several large suitcases, golf clubs, a stroller or bulky equipment. Describe the luggage honestly instead of choosing only by passenger count.
Why families and small groups often choose an SUV
A full-size black SUV gives families and small groups additional seating and cargo flexibility. It is well suited to airport transfers, cruise travel and longer trips where passengers have checked bags and carry-ons.
Car seats also influence usable seating. Tell the transportation provider how many seats are needed and the age or size of each child. Wright Executive Transportation offers car seats by advance request at no additional charge, subject to availability.
When a Sprinter van is the better solution
Sprinter vans are useful for larger parties, corporate groups, wedding transportation and travelers carrying substantial luggage. Keeping everyone in one planned vehicle can simplify communication and reduce the risk of part of the group arriving separately.
Vehicle configurations vary, so passenger and luggage capacity should always be confirmed for the specific trip. Do not assume that every seat can be occupied when every traveler also has a large suitcase.
Use a complete passenger-and-bag count
Before requesting a quote, count adults, children, checked suitcases, carry-ons, strollers, wheelchairs, golf clubs and other large items. Mention any covered luggage-hitch requirements, accessibility considerations or extra stops.
This information allows the transportation company to recommend a practical option instead of discovering a space issue at the curb.
Match the vehicle to the whole trip
Consider the distance, number of stops and purpose of travel. A sedan may be ideal for an executive traveling from TPA to a downtown meeting. An SUV may suit a family going to Clearwater Beach, while a Sprinter can be more appropriate for a conference group or cruise party.
